- Curly vs Kinky Hair: What’s the Difference? - Burlybands
There are four ways that kinky hair and curly hair differ from one another: Firstly, curly hair has a more pronounced "S" shape compared to kinky hair, which has a more "Z" shape Second, kinky hair has springier, tighter, and smaller curls than curly hair and is more prone to shrinkage
